Background
The LED candle lamp adopts a high-power high-brightness light source, the color of the product can be selected from a plurality of colors such as color temperature of 2600K to 3200K, the base adopts aluminum alloy, the surface of the base is oxidized, the internal special ventilation structure design has the advantages of light weight, good heat dissipation, attractive and high-grade appearance and the like, and the lampshade is made of transparent or opal glass.

Drawings
FIG. 1 is a schematic structural view of the present invention;
FIG. 2 is a cross-sectional view of the lamp cap connection structure according to the present invention;
fig. 3 is a front view of a diode connection structure in the structure of the present invention.
In the figure: the LED lamp comprises a lamp holder 1, spiral threads 2, a connector 3, a circuit board 4, a through hole 5, a heat conducting block 6, an internal block 7, a diode 8, a supporting wire 9, a conducting wire 10, a lamp filament 11, a lamp shell 12 and a fixing block 13.

Referring to fig. 1-3, the efficient and durable LED candle bulb in this embodiment includes a lamp cap 1, a spiral pattern 2 is formed on an outer side of the lamp cap 1, a connector 3 is fixedly connected to a bottom of the lamp cap 1, a circuit board 4 is disposed inside the lamp cap 1, a bottom of the circuit board 4 is connected to the connector 3 through a wire, a through hole 5 is formed on an outer side of the lamp cap 1, the number of the through holes 5 is two, the two through holes 5 are bilaterally and symmetrically distributed, a heat conduction block 6 is fixedly connected to an inner side of the lamp cap 1, the heat conduction block 6 is in a ring shape, a protrusion is disposed on each of left and right sides of the heat conduction block 6, the protrusion of the heat conduction block 6 is adapted to the inner side of the through hole 5, a fixed block 13 is fixedly connected to the inner side of the lamp cap 1, the fixed block 13 is fixedly connected to the circuit board 4, the fixed block 13 is located in the middle of the heat conduction block 6, grooves are formed on front and back sides of the fixed block 13, the heat conduction block 6 is located in the groove of the fixed block 13, inside piece 7 of top fixedly connected with of fixed block 13, the top of circuit board 4 is connected with inside piece 7 through the electric wire, the top fixedly connected with diode 8 of inside piece 7, the top fixedly connected with supporting filament 9 of diode 8, the inboard fixedly connected with conduction silk 10 of supporting filament 9, conduction silk 10 is the type of protruding font, the outside fixedly connected with filament 11 of corresponding conduction silk 10, the quantity of filament 11 is four, and filament 11 is the equidistance and arranges the distribution, the inboard threaded connection of lamp holder 1 has lamp body 12.
The working principle of the above embodiment is as follows: spiral line 2 through the lamp holder 1 outside is connected with the external connection seat, then at connector 3, circuit board 4, inside piece 7, diode 8, filament 11 can be lighted in the cooperation between supporting filament 9 and the conduction silk 10, lamp body 12 can play the protectiveness to the candle bulb, and can improve the luminous efficacy of filament 11, when inside production of heat, adsorb the heat through heat conduction piece 6, then lug and through-hole 5's on heat conduction piece 6 cooperation, can outwards derive the heat, thereby play radiating effect, consequently, can improve the life of candle bulb.
